DOW-UAP-D038: Range Fouler Debrief, Arabian Gulf, May 2020

This file is a standardized U.S. Navy 'Range Fouler Debrief' form, used to report unauthorized intrusions into controlled airspace during military operations or training. Dated 05/14/20 at 20:40:00 Z, it records a nighttime ISR observation in the Arabian Gulf. The reporter describes a single solid white object flying through the field-of-view, briefly lost and re-acquired, that appeared to make erratic movements above the water. The sensor operator manipulated the sensor to maintain track; 4x zoom was obtained before the object was lost due to poor track placement. Aircraft-relevant data includes side number 28314, BuNo 49524, contact altitude ~20,000–22,000, and an intermittent trackfile. The releasing agency notes that all descriptive and estimative language reflects the reporter's subjective interpretation and should not be taken as conclusive evidence of object features or performance. The form was declassified by MG Richard A. Harrison, USCENTCOM Chief of Staff, marked USCENTCOM MDR 26-0019, and approved for release to AARO on 01/26/26. It is paired with video PR-036 (DVIDS Video ID 1006083).

Please use the field below to describe the contact and any interiaction in your own words with as much
detail as possible. Please be sure to include any detail not incl ded in questions above.
While preforming an ISR tasking (UL TN/Black Hot/Lin), a solid w ite 1object flew through the FOV. There
was a temporarily lose of the object but re-acquired shortly there after. The crew was able to follow the
object as it appeared to make erratic moments above the water. During the follow, crew was able to obtain
4x zoom on the object but lost the object due to poor track place ent. While following, the sensor operator
was continuously manipulating the sensor to maintain eyes on th1e object. This is apparent by the waves of
the water in the background being visible and not being visible.
